【嵌入式培训之了解下树莓派是什么】在嵌入式系统的学习过程中,树莓派(Raspberry Pi)是一个非常重要的学习工具。它不仅被广泛用于教学和开发,还被许多爱好者用来进行各种项目实践。下面是对树莓派的基本介绍和相关特性的总结。
一、树莓派简介
树莓派是一款由英国树莓派基金会(Raspberry Pi Foundation)设计的微型计算机。它体积小巧、价格低廉,但功能强大,支持多种操作系统,如Raspbian、Ubuntu等。树莓派最初是为了促进计算机科学教育而设计的,但现在已经成为嵌入式开发、物联网(IoT)、机器人控制等多个领域的热门硬件平台。
二、树莓派的主要特点
特性 | 描述 |
尺寸 | 非常小,适合嵌入式应用 |
处理器 | 通常搭载ARM架构的CPU |
内存 | 根据型号不同,内存从512MB到4GB不等 |
存储 | 使用microSD卡作为存储介质 |
接口 | 提供USB、HDMI、以太网、GPIO等接口 |
操作系统 | 支持Linux系统,如Raspbian、Ubuntu等 |
功耗 | 低功耗,适合长时间运行 |
价格 | 相对便宜,适合学生和开发者 |
三、树莓派的应用场景
应用场景 | 说明 |
教育 | 用于编程教学、电子工程实验等 |
家庭自动化 | 可作为智能家居控制器 |
媒体中心 | 可以搭建媒体播放器或流媒体服务器 |
物联网 | 用于传感器数据采集与处理 |
机器人控制 | 作为机器人的“大脑”进行控制 |
开发测试 | 用于嵌入式系统的原型开发和调试 |
四、常见型号对比
型号 | CPU | 内存 | 网络 | USB端口 | 价格(约) |
Raspberry Pi 3 B+ | ARM Cortex-A53 @ 1.4GHz | 1GB | 无线/WiFi | 4个 | ¥300 |
Raspberry Pi 4B | ARM Cortex-A72 @ 1.5GHz | 2GB/4GB | 有线/无线 | 4个 | ¥400-600 |
Raspberry Pi Zero W | ARM Cortex-A5 @ 1GHz | 512MB | 无线 | 1个 | ¥150 |
Raspberry Pi 5 | ARM Cortex-A72 @ 2.4GHz | 4GB | 有线/无线 | 4个 | ¥800 |
五、学习建议
对于初学者来说,可以从基础型号开始,如Raspberry Pi 3 B+或Zero W,逐步过渡到更高级的型号。同时,建议搭配一些学习资源,如官方文档、教程视频、社区论坛等,以便更好地掌握树莓派的使用方法和开发技巧。
通过以上内容可以看出,树莓派不仅是一款优秀的嵌入式学习工具,更是连接理论与实践的重要桥梁。无论是学生还是开发者,都可以从中获得丰富的实践经验和技术提升。